usb: dwc3: Add a property to disable USB2 LPM



Add an option to disable USB2 LPM from host. There maybe cases where the
user does not want to enable USB2 LPM (e.g. USB2 LPM is broken).

@@ -37,6 +37,7 @@ Optional properties:
 - phy-names: from the *Generic PHY* bindings; supported names are "usb2-phy"
	or "usb3-phy".
 - resets: a single pair of phandle and reset specifier
 - snps,usb2-lpm-disable: indicate if we don't want to enable USB2 HW LPM
 - snps,usb3_lpm_capable: determines if platform is USB3 LPM capable
 - snps,disable_scramble_quirk: true when SW should disable data scrambling.
	Only really useful for FPGA builds.
